What is a list view?
A list view is a table of records within a Pavilion tab.
For example, when you open Customers, Inventory, Jobs, or Sales, Pavilion displays records in a list view.
List views can help you:
View a specific group of records
Sort records by column
Filter records by criteria
Choose which fields appear in the table
Open individual records

Open a list view
1. Select the tab that contains the records you want to view. For example, select Customers, Inventory, Jobs, or Sales.
2. Pavilion opens the default list view for that tab.
3. Click on the List Views dropdown to view other available list views for that topic.
Note: Each List View provides a different set of filters and sorting options to organize the records.

Edit a list view
1. Open the tab where you want to create the list view.
2. Select the List View Controls icon.
3. Under List View Controls, select ‘Clone’ to make a copy of the current list view.
Note: List Views cannot be edited, so if your goal is to edit an existing list view, first select Clone.
4. Enter a list name.
5. Select who can access and view this list view: only you, or all users, including Partner and Customer Portal users.
6. Click the Save button. The Filters panel appears.
7. Click Select Fields to Display.
8. Click on the column header you want to move, and then click the right arrow button to move the column to the visible fields.
To Arrange the Column Order in the List View:
Within the “Visible Fields” section, you have the option to arrange the order of the columns. Click on the column header you want to move, and then click the ‘up/down’ button to reorder them based on your preference.
9. Click Save.
10. Click Filter by Owner.
11. Add and set filters to view only the records that meet your criteria.
12. Click Done.
13. Click Add Filter.
14. Select the field to filter, an operator, and a value.
15. Click Done.
16. Click the Save button. The view appears in the list view dropdown list, so you can access it later. Pin a list view if you want it to load as the default list for that object.
Delete a List View
1. You can delete a list view when you no longer need it. Under List View Controls, select Delete, then confirm the deletion of the list view.
